The former Acting Accountant General of the Federation, Chukwunyere Anamekwe Nwabuoku, on Wednesday, July 16, 2025, requested additional time to file a no-case submission in his ongoing trial before Justice James Omotosho at the Federal High Court in Maitama, Abuja.
Nwabuoku, who is being prosecuted by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), faces a nine-count amended charge bordering on alleged money laundering totalling ₦868,465,000.
At the last court sitting, the defence counsel, Isadore Udenko, had informed the court of his client’s intention to file a no-case submission at the next hearing. However, during Wednesday’s proceedings, the defence said it needed more time to finalise preparations for the application.
